The Basic Math: The Rectangular Standard
Most of us have a rectangle. Its the classic look. The math reflects that simplicity. To find the cubic inch volume, you obsession three numbers. Length. Width. Height. But here is the catch. Most people play-act the outdoor of the glass. The glass can be half an inch thick! That adds up.
Always be active the inside dimensions if you desire the true water capacity. If the glass is thick, you might be losing two or three gallons of space. To calculate fish tank size, multiply the Length (inches) x Width (inches) x peak (inches). This gives you sum cubic inches. Now, here is the magic number. Divide that sum by 231.
Why 231? Because there are exactly 231 cubic inches in one US liquid gallon. Its a weird number. I don't know who settled it, but its the sham of the land. Lets tell your tank is 48 inches long, 12 inches wide, and 21 inches high. Multiply them: 48 x 12 x 21 = 12,096. Now divide by 231. You acquire 52.36 gallons. Your "55-gallon" tank is actually just greater than 52 gallons. This is what we call the nominal aquarium volume. Its rarely what the sticker says.
The Displacement Secret: The "Fake" Space
Here is something nobody tells you in the store. Your tank will never actually withhold 52 gallons of water. Why? Because you aren't keeping a bare glass box. You have three inches of aquarium substrate. You have a huge piece of Seiryu stone. You have a huge sponge filter. This is the aquarium displacement factor.
When I set stirring my Discus tank, I accounted for this. I realized my 90-gallon tank solitary held more or less 78 gallons of actual liquid. The get off was sand and wood. This is crucial for dosing aquarium meds. If the bottle says "one capful per 10 gallons," and you have 78 gallons but treat for 90, you are making a mistake. I always subtract 10% to 15% from the total volume to acquire the net water volume. Its a safer bet.
Think nearly it. If you put a giant bowling ball in a bucket of water, the water level rises. The ball takes the place of the water. Your stifling rocks pull off the thesame thing. This is the displaced water calculation. Always be conservative. Its enlarged to under-dose a little than to slant your tank into a chemical bath.

Step-by-Step Summary for Accuracy
- Grab a metal autograph album measure. Don't use a fabric one; they stretch.
- Measure the length. Inside edge to inside edge.
- Measure the width. front to back, inside the glass.
- Measure the height. From the top of the substrate to the water linenot the top of the glass!
- Multiply L x W x H.
- Divide by 231.
- Subtract 5-10% for decor.
This gives you the realistic aquarium volume. Its the number you should use for everything. For your GPH filter rating. For your LED spacious intensity. For your CO2 injection rates.
